検索エンジンとは?仕組み・歴史・SEOとの関係を初心者にもわかりやすく解説【現代Webの核となる技術】

インターネットで調べ物をするとき、最も利用されるツールが 検索エンジン(Search Engine) です。
Google・Yahoo!・Bing・DuckDuckGo などが代表的で、検索エンジンは現代のWeb体験を支える最重要インフラと言えます。

この記事では、検索エンジンとは何か、その仕組み、どうやって情報を探し出しているのか、そしてSEOとの関係までを初心者にもわかりやすく整理して解説します。


◆ 検索エンジンとは?

検索エンジンとは、
インターネット上の膨大な情報から、ユーザーの検索意図に合ったページを探し、順位をつけて表示するシステム
のことです。

例:

  • Google
  • Bing
  • Yahoo!(Googleの検索エンジンを採用)
  • DuckDuckGo

検索エンジンは人間の代わりに、世界中のWebページの内容を読み取り、分類し、整理したうえで最適な結果を返しています。


◆ 検索エンジンの3つの主要プロセス

検索エンジンは、以下の仕組みで情報を収集・整理・検索します。


● 1. クローリング(Crawling)

Webサイトを巡回して情報を自動収集するプロセス。

検索エンジンのロボット(クローラー)が
リンクをたどりながらページを発見し続けます。


● 2. インデックス(Indexing)

収集したページの内容を解析し、データベースに登録する作業。

ポイント:

  • ページのテキスト内容
  • タイトルや見出し
  • 画像の情報(alt テキスト)
  • 重要語句や構造化データ

検索の“辞書”を作るイメージです。


● 3. ランキング(Ranking)

ユーザーの検索意図に合うページを順番に並べて表示。

ランキングには多くの要素が関わります。

  • コンテンツの品質(E-E-A-T)
  • ページの専門性
  • 被リンク(外部リンク)
  • ページの読み込み速度
  • モバイル対応
  • ユーザー行動データ
  • 検索意図の一致度

Googleの場合、200以上の指標で順位を評価すると言われています。


◆ 検索エンジンの歴史(かんたん解説)

  • 1990年代:Yahoo!「ディレクトリ型」検索が登場
  • 1998年:Googleが PageRank アルゴリズムで世界を変える
  • 2000年代:SEOの概念が普及
  • 2010年代:AIによる検索理解が進化(Hummingbird / RankBrain)
  • 2020年代:検索 + AIアシスタントの融合(SGE など)

現在の検索エンジンは、
AIによって検索意図(クエリ)を深く理解する方向へ進化しています。


◆ 検索エンジンが使われる場面

  • Web検索
  • 企業内検索(社内文書の検索)
  • ECサイトの商品検索
  • SNSの投稿検索
  • 画像・動画検索
  • コード検索
  • 音声検索
  • 地図検索(ローカル検索)

“検索”はあらゆるアプリやサービスに組み込まれています。


◆ 検索エンジンとSEOの関係

SEO(Search Engine Optimization)とは、
検索エンジンにページ内容を正しく理解させ、上位表示を狙う取り組みです。

SEOで重視される要素:

● コンテンツの品質(専門性・権威性・信頼性)

● 適切なタイトルと見出し

● 内部リンク・外部リンク

● サイトの表示速度

● モバイル表示最適化

● 構造化データ

● 画像の alt テキスト

検索エンジンの仕組みを理解することは、SEO戦略にも直結します。


◆ 検索エンジンのメリット

  • 必要な情報に即時アクセス
  • 世界中の知識を整理・活用
  • ECやSNSでも検索が欠かせない
  • 調査・学習・娯楽など幅広く利用可能
  • 企業のビジネスにも直結する重要ツール

◆ 検索エンジンの課題

  • スパムサイト・偽情報の排除
  • ランク操作(ブラックハットSEO)
  • AI生成コンテンツの品質管理
  • プライバシー保護

検索エンジン側も常にアップデートを続けています。


◆ まとめ:検索エンジンは“Web全体の案内人”となる存在

検索エンジンは、

  • 世界中のWebページを収集
  • 内容を理解して整理
  • ユーザーの意図に合わせて順位付け
  • AIの進化により日々精度向上

という特徴を持つ、現代のインターネットになくてはならない技術です。

SEOを考えるうえでも、検索エンジンの仕組みを理解することは重要なステップとなります。